A musty smell in the basement or crawl space is usually moisture you can't see yet, not just "old house smell."
Stair-step cracks in block foundations are a common early warning sign we see across Waukesha-area homes.
It's easy to dismiss efflorescence as harmless dust, but it actually signals active moisture movement through the wall.
If your pump is running around the clock instead of only during storms, it's worth having it evaluated before it fails completely.
A bowing basement wall is a structural concern in addition to a water one â this is the kind of Waukesha call we prioritize fast.
Peeling paint low on a basement wall or warped baseboards upstairs often trace back to moisture migrating up from below.
